    Fever Face Elimination as WNBA Prepares for Possible Caitlin Clark Home Playoff Debut

    The Indiana Fever face a do-or-die situation in Wednesday night’s playoff game against the Connecticut Sun, as they battle to extend their series to a decisive Game 3. The Fever, who fell 93-69 in Game 1, must overcome a tough stretch that includes four losses in their last five matchups with the Sun, including regular-season games. Head coach Christie Sides is tasked with making strategic adjustments to keep the Fever's postseason dreams alive.

    In the spotlight is rookie sensation Caitlin Clark, who struggled in Game 1, scoring just 11 points on 4-of-17 shooting. The Fever will need to create more opportunities for Clark to shine if they hope to force a Game 3. Should Indiana secure a victory on Wednesday, the potential Game 3 would mark Clark's first home playoff appearance—a moment that could draw one of the largest crowds in WNBA history.

    The WNBA announced that this potential matchup, scheduled for Friday at 7:30 PM ET on ESPN2, would take place in Indianapolis. Fever fans are eagerly awaiting the outcome, as a home playoff game could electrify the city and bring the Fever one step closer to a deep postseason run.
